嵌入子页面的意义
在前端网页开发中,嵌入子页面是一种非常常见的技术手段。它可以将一个页面拆分成多个子页面,使得代码更加清晰易懂,同时还能提高页面的加载速度和用户体验。下面我们来看一下如何在html中嵌入子页面。
使用iframe标签嵌入子页面
iframe标签是html中嵌入子页面的一种方法。它可以在一个页面中嵌入另一个页面,并且可以设置宽度、高度、边框等属性。下面是一个使用iframe标签嵌入子页面的例子:
```
```
其中,src属性指定了要嵌入的子页面的地址,width和height属性分别指定了iframe的宽度和高度,frameborder属性指定了是否显示边框。
使用object标签嵌入子页面
除了iframe标签,还可以使用object标签来嵌入子页面。object标签可以嵌入各种类型的媒体文件,包括html页面。下面是一个使用object标签嵌入子页面的例子:
```

```
其中,type属性指定了要嵌入的文件类型,data属性指定了要嵌入的子页面的地址,width和height属性分别指定了object的宽度和高度。
使用ajax技术嵌入子页面
除了以上两种方法,还可以使用ajax技术来嵌入子页面。ajax技术可以通过异步加载页面内容,提高页面的加载速度和用户体验。下面是一个使用ajax技术嵌入子页面的例子:
```
var xhr = new XMLHttpRequest();
xhr.open('GET', '子页面地址', true);
xhr.onreadystatechange = function() {
if (xhr.readyState === 4 && xhr.status === 200) {
document.getElementById('子页面容器').innerHTML = xhr.responseText;
}
};
xhr.send();
```
其中,xhr对象是ajax请求对象,open方法指定了请求的方法、地址和是否异步,onreadystatechange事件处理函数用于处理请求的状态变化,innerHTML属性用于将子页面内容添加到页面中。
总结
以上就是html嵌入子页面的三种方法。使用iframe标签、object标签和ajax技术都可以实现嵌入子页面的效果,具体选择哪种方法要根据实际情况来决定。无论使用哪种方法,都需要注意子页面的大小和加载速度,以保证用户体验。